U.S. sanctions Cuban President Miguel Diaz-Canel in latest move to pressure island's leadership

The United States has imposed sanctions on Cuban President Miguel Diaz-Canel, along with his wife and three other individuals, according to a filing Thursday from the U.S. Treasury Department. It's the latest Trump administration move to pressure the island's leadership.
